Denied
The Board denied the appellant's claim for dependency and indemnity compensation (DIC), death pension, and accrued benefits as she was not legally the surviving spouse of the Veteran.
The deciding factor: The probative evidence established that the marriage between the appellant and the Veteran terminated by divorce prior to his death, thus denying her standing to bring a claim for DIC, death pension, and accrued benefits.
